How much do in events j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for in events in Edison, NJ is $21.32,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.16 and $24.38 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an in events job?

In events jobs refer to a wide range of roles involved in planning, organizing, and executing events such as conferences, weddings, corporate meetings, concerts, and festivals. People working in this field can take on positions like event coordinator, manager, planner, or support staff, handling everything from logistics and budgeting to marketing and on-the-day execution. These jobs require strong organizational, communication, and problem-solving skills, as well as the ability to work under pressure and adapt to changing circumstances.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the events industry?

To thrive in the events industry,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and relevant experience or education in event planning or hospitality. Familiarity with event management software, budgeting tools, and registration systems is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and flexibility are crucial soft skills for managing diverse stakeholders and adapting to changing circumstances. These qualities ensure successful event execution, client satisfaction, and the ability to handle unexpected challenges.

What are some common challenges faced when coordinating events, and how can they be managed effectively?

Event coordinators often encounter challenges such as last-minute changes, tight deadlines, and vendor communication issues. Managing these effectively requires strong organizational skills, flexibility, and the ability to remain calm under pressure. Building contingency plans, maintaining clear communication with all stakeholders, and keeping detailed checklists can help ensure smooth event execution. Collaborating closely with team members and vendors is also essential for addressing unexpected issues quickly and efficiently.

Job description


The world's leading organizations and global players choose Proskauer to represent them when they need it the most. With 800+ lawyers in key financial centers around the world, we are known for our pragmatic and business-savvy approach.
Proskauer is the place to turn when a matter is complex, innovative and game-changing. We work seamlessly across practices, industries and jurisdictions with asset managers, private equity and venture capital firms, Fortune 500 and FTSE companies, major sports leagues, entertainment industry legends and other industry-redefining companies.
The Events Specialist executes events that strengthen attorney relationships, support practice group development, and enhance firm culture. This role focuses on flawless tactical execution of events and the ideal candidate is highly organized, detail-oriented, and thrives in a fast-paced environment while maintaining professional standards across all touchpoints.
Responsibilities
  • Event Execution:
    • Execute end-to-end event logistics including venue research and selection, vendor coordination, contract processing, registration management, on-site production, and post-event follow-up.
    • Manage event production elements: run-of-show development, branding implementation, audio/visual coordination, attendee communications, and materials preparation.
    • Maintain registration systems, create attendance reports, and ensure accurate event documentation.
    • Serve as primary support on flagship events working under Associate Director's direction.
  • Vendor and Resource Management:
    • Develop and maintain relationships with venue contacts and event vendors across New York and key domestic markets.
    • Build and maintain venue database for ongoing planning reference.
    • Research new venues and present recommendations to Associate Director based on event requirements.
    • Coordinate promotional materials procurement and inventory management.
  • Project Management:
    • Use project management tools to track timelines, budgets, deliverables, and stakeholder communications.
    • Develop detailed event schedules, run-of-shows, and coordination documents.
    • Ensure compliance with firm policies and venue requirements.
    • Process vendor invoicing and maintain budget tracking documentation.
  • Collaboration:
    • Partner with Business Development, Marketing & Communications (BDMC) team members and Firm Business Services to deliver cohesive event experiences.
    • Communicate effectively with attorneys and staff at all levels.
    • Support Associate Director in implementing process improvements and best practices.

Qualifications
  • Experience:
    • 3-5 years in event planning, preferably in professional services or hospitality.
  • Education:
    • Bachelor's degree in Marketing, Communications, Business, or Hospitality Management.
  • Technical Skills:
    • Proficiency with Microsoft Office suite (Outlook, Word, Excel, PowerPoint).
    • Experience with event platforms (Cvent, BeaconLive, Foundation, InterAction).
    • Familiarity with AI tools to enhance workflows, automate processes, and improve decision-making.
  • Core Competencies:
    • Exceptional organizational and project management skills.
    • Strong written and verbal communication abilities.
    • Ability to prioritize multiple projects under tight deadlines.
    • Resourceful problem-solver who works independently and collaboratively.
    • Professional demeanor with discretion and judgment.
    • Familiarity with New York City venues preferred.
  • Logistics:
    • Flexibility for extended and irregular hours with domestic travel to support off-site events.

This position will require physical presence in Proskauer's offices on a regular basis (at least 3x per week, or more, if it becomes the policy of the Firm or as business needs require). The anticipated compensation for this position is $90,000-$110,000. The actual salary offered will be based on a number of factors, including but not limited to the qualifications of the applicant, years of relevant experience, level of education attained, certifications or other professional licenses held, and if applicable, the location in which the applicant lives and/or from which they will be performing the job.
